In observance of Memorial Day, Governor Kay Ivey has released a special video message paying tribute to U.S. service members who gave their lives in defense of the country. She is joined in the tribute by Alabama Department of Veterans Affairs Commissioner Jeff Newton and Alabama National Guard Adjutant General David Pritchett.
The video features individual reflections from each leader, highlighting the solemn significance of Memorial Day. Together, they express gratitude to the families of the fallen and encourage Alabamians to pause and honor those who gave everything in service to the nation.
They emphasize the importance of remembering those who never returned home, underscoring the holiday's role as a day of national reflection and gratitude.

Memorial Day, observed on the final Monday of May, honors the memory of the men and women who died while serving in the U.S. Armed Forces.
